Nachhilfe In Primary School (Grades 3–4)

In many federal states, English already begins in grade 3, sometimes even earlier. Teachers are supposed to introduce the language in a playful way, even though the children are at the same time consolidating reading and writing in German. This is where our English tutoring comes in: we revise vocabulary with the children, practise simple sentences and train listening comprehension before gaps become bigger.

Transition To Secondary Schools: Hauptschule, Realschule, Gesamtschule, Gymnasium

The change after grade 4 is a big step for many children. Suddenly there are more subjects, more teachers and often significantly more English lessons. When we offer online English tutoring in this phase, it is not only about grammar, but also about organisation, homework planning and exam anxiety.

Together we look at what the respective type of school requires:

  • In Realschule and Gymnasium, texts, listening comprehension and small presentations appear on the timetable early on.
  • In Hauptschule, everyday dialogues are particularly important so that young people can later communicate in their jobs.

Nachhilfe For Lower Secondary (Grades 5–10)

In lower secondary school it is often decided how confident students will be at the end of Sekundarstufe I. Grammar becomes more complex, texts get longer and oral participation is weighted more strongly. Our online English tutoring therefore focuses on three areas: grammar, vocabulary and application.

We use targeted English grammar exercises so that structures such as tenses, if-clauses and passive voice are really understood. Afterwards we transfer these contents into short writing tasks and role plays so that the rules do not remain dry.
